Camshaft Position Sensor: Description and Operation
PURPOSE
The Camshaft Position (CMP) sensor provides camshaft rotational location information to Powertrain Control Module (PCM).
OPERATION
The camshaft position sensor is a variable reluctance sensor that is triggered by the high point mark on the camshaft. The PCM uses the camshaft position signal for sequencing the ignition coils. The PCM also uses the CMP signal for fuel injector synchronization.
